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8940911 856488 9371358481
4456 672127 76
4456 672127 76
04956527 5251459 7611819250
All about undefined
Interested in learning more?
4456 672127 76
04956527 5251459 7611819250
See more
566 12450966220
56724455 5423 013 6583003
See more
691182 65700
323 85 65185 83 4396460
See more